Output 06e8a32b21424929e13cbf897cdb89b2c881ff1018703000c3c5f950ecdc3993:47

value
2052525
script pubkey
OP_0 OP_PUSHBYTES_20 5ab1f2be81acdd598fb22e6fc1f13dad5ce237dd
address
bc1qt2cl905p4nw4nraj9ehurufa44wwyd7a72wp5r
transaction
06e8a32b21424929e13cbf897cdb89b2c881ff1018703000c3c5f950ecdc3993
spent
true